2 During the training program, we learned who we were going to call as well as how to approach the phone call. We called the Sixers single game ticket buyers and then former Sixers ticket purchasers from previous seasons dating back to 2006 who were in their Salesforce.com database. The first part of the phone call and the hardest part of the job was to understand the opening and get the customer to feel relaxed through the opening and introduction. We were taught to smile and first understand who we were calling by saying their name and the game that they attended to get a yes response right away. We were taught the process of building rapport with the client. The rapport rule was to build rapport by talking to people briefly about something in which they are interested. This was the first thing that we had to remember and were quizzed on in order to show the importance of this message so that we always remembered this statement throughout the internship. We also learned the 76ers sales model that started with trying to honestly seeing things from the other person s point of view. The sales process included three elements which were the buyer, sales element, and ourselves. The buyer first came into the phone conversation with preoccupation, and it was our job to build rapport by selling ourselves at first. Then we moved to the indifference factor of the client where as a sales intern we needed to create interest by showing the customer the need for tickets to a Phillies game. The next interference buyer s would put up was doubt which is then where we learned how to provide a solution by selling value of the attending a 76ers home game with their friends or family. The fourth problem in this five stage process was the buyer s procrastination to purchase, which we then needed to find motive and show the urgency to purchase the tickets right now. Finally, the last step was
3 overcoming the buyer s reluctance by selling decisions to find a commitment. This was the five stage process of selling tickets to customers to make sales on behalf of the Philadelphia 76ers. We were tasked with selling the 76ers three game packages first, which included three different plans and eight different seating locations. It was quite a lot of information to learn, but I made sure I took good notes and had a strong understanding to be able to do the best that I could. The three game plans ranged from $72 to $714 for the center six tickets, which were lower level seats in the center of the basketball court. The red plan included games against the Dallas Mavericks, New York Knicks, and Detroit Pistons. The white plan was a weekend plan with games against the Boston Celtics, Sacramento Kings, and Toronto Raptors. The last plan, blue plan, had games against the Oklahoma City Thunder, Atlanta Hawks, and Orlando Magic. As the internship progressed, we were challenged with the opportunity to sell group tickets and next season ticket packages ranging from 10-game plans and full season plans that offered playoff priority. I took it into my own hands to reach out to potential businesses that I had connections with that I knew attended other sporting events as well as anyone I knew who had an interest in the 76ers. I reached out to Penn Stainless Steel to see if they had any interest in purchasing tickets to the 76ers for their employees to attend and offer incentives for their own company s employees. I developed a strategic plan on how I was going to market and sell the 10 game plan as a way for the company to test out the experience of attending the 76ers games before going into a full season package. My idea worked and I was able to sell a 10 game plan in the center-6 section of the stadium which were the most expensive seat that we were able to sell. The total value of the deal was worth $4760, which was a huge close for myself, as well as a huge boost for our night sales team to reach the goal of $20,000 in sales at the end of the internship set by our supervisor. I also was able to make an one-call close for a ten game plan while I was in the office with a client that included a mezzanine center purchase for 10 games the following season in addition to purchasing mezzanine outside center tickets to the playoff series against the Miami Heat. This was my best sale throughout the internship since I learned everything that I was taught to make a sale of this magnitude in one phone call. I was very excited after this sale because it put me into first place overall. I was the only freshman to get the internship and I was the highest sales person in the night sales internship selling over $6,600
5 in a nine week period individually, while selling over $20,000 being a part of the nine member night sales team. I also executed the largest amount of phone calls throughout the internship which really showed my work ethic and desire to achieve the most. I averaged over 60 cold calls daily to increase my sales pipeline, which usually was a three hour cold calling period.
